DISCOVER THE EXTENSIVE WEB SOLUTIONS HANDBOOK FOR A COMPREHENSIVE INTRODUCTION TO COMMUNICATION PROTOCOLS-YOUR SECRET TO UNLOCKING THE GLOBE OF WEB SOLUTIONS

Discover The Extensive Web Solutions Handbook For A Comprehensive Introduction To Communication Protocols-Your Secret To Unlocking The Globe Of Web Solutions

Discover The Extensive Web Solutions Handbook For A Comprehensive Introduction To Communication Protocols-Your Secret To Unlocking The Globe Of Web Solutions

Blog Article

Web Content By-Riley Alvarez

Discover the best Web Services Manual for all your requirements. Check out communication methods, core principles of SOAP and remainder, and ideal techniques for smooth application. Discover the keys to grasping internet services, from comprehending the basics to implementing scalable architecture. search engine optimization services near me of designing safe and secure systems and enhancing for future growth. Unlock the power of web services at your fingertips.

Introduction of Web Providers



If you've ever questioned what internet solutions are and how they work, this introduction is the excellent location to begin. Web services are a means for various applications to connect with each other over the internet. They enable seamless combination of systems, making it much easier to share information and performances.

Among the key elements of web services is their use typical methods like HTTP and XML to help with interaction. This standardization makes sure that various systems can understand and engage with each other efficiently. Web services can be classified right into 2 major kinds: SOAP (Simple Things Accessibility Procedure) and REST (Representational State Transfer).

SOAP is a method that utilizes XML for message exchange, while REST relies upon standard HTTP approaches like GET, PUBLISH, PUT, and DELETE. Both have their toughness and are used in various circumstances based upon demands.

Key Ideas and Technologies



Discovering the foundational concepts and innovations of web services is crucial for recognizing their capability and application in modern systems. When diving into the essential ideas and innovations of web services, you open the door to a world of interconnected possibilities. Here are some essential elements to comprehend:

- ** SOAP (Simple Things Gain Access To Protocol) **: This protocol defines the structure of messages exchanged in between web services.
- ** WSDL (Web Services Summary Language) **: WSDL is made use of to describe the capabilities offered by a web solution.
- ** REMAINDER (Representational State Transfer) **: A building design that utilizes common HTTP approaches for communication between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ays an essential role in information exchange between internet solutions due to its convenience and readability.

Understanding these core principles and technologies will lay a strong foundation for your trip right into the world of web solutions.

Best Practices for Execution



To ensure effective execution of web solutions, prioritize adherence to finest methods. Begin by extensively recording your internet service APIs, consisting of clear descriptions of endpoints, parameters, and expected responses. Regular naming conventions and versioning of APIs are important for maintainability. When creating your internet services, follow the concepts of remainder to develop a scalable and flexible style. Apply appropriate verification and authorization devices to protect your solutions, such as OAuth or API tricks.

Testing is crucial in making certain the integrity of your internet solutions. Establish comprehensive test cases that cover numerous situations, including positive and negative screening. Continual integration and automated screening can help catch issues early in the growth procedure. https://website-and-marketing-com61616.actoblog.com/27093341/attain-web-design-excellence-with-straightforward-ideas-and-techniques-that-elevate-your-website-s-individual-experience in real-time to identify performance bottlenecks and prospective failings. Logging and mistake handling are crucial for diagnosing concerns and troubleshooting troubles properly.



Lastly, think about the scalability of your internet solutions by designing for future development. https://customerthink.com/how-to-prepare-your-digital-marketing-strategy-for-2022/ caching mechanisms and load harmonizing to handle boosted web traffic. Consistently evaluation and enhance your code for efficiency. By following these finest methods, you can simplify the application of internet services and ensure their success.

Final thought

Congratulations! You've simply unlocked the secret to mastering web services. By comprehending the essential ideas and innovations, and carrying out best techniques, you're well on your way to coming to be a web solutions expert.

Keep exploring and experimenting with what please click the following post have actually learned to continue broadening your expertise and abilities in this interesting area.

The globe of internet solutions is currently within your reaches, ready for you to discover and dominate. Enjoy the journey!